Three Belgian cyclists, including Paul (28), were seriously injured in a collision in France: “It was a heavy blow”, his father testifies

On Thursday evening, a car drove into a group of cyclists in the French municipality of Genech, close to the Belgian border. The group consisted of ten French and Belgian cyclists. Five of them were hit. Three Belgians – Noé (17), Paul (28) and Pascal (50) – were seriously injured. Paul is still in mortal danger, his father tells RTL Info. “He’s lost a lot of blood.”
